The Bourbon County Commission meeting on December 12, 2024, highlighted several key developments that will impact the community in the coming months. Among the most notable discussions was the scheduled blasting at Blake Query, set for January 7, 2025, pending favorable weather conditions. This project aims to advance local infrastructure, although concerns about potential mud at the site were raised.

In addition to the blasting schedule, the commission discussed the rescheduling of a bridge project at Sixtieth and Grand. The project’s letting has been pushed back from February 25 to April 25, which may affect local traffic and construction timelines.

The county's snow removal preparations were also a focal point of the meeting. Officials confirmed that all snow equipment is ready for the winter season, with four trucks operational and a fifth truck set to be equipped with necessary attachments after the new year. This readiness is crucial for maintaining safe road conditions during winter storms.

Another significant topic was the support for Pinnacle Broadband's application for the Broadband Equity Access Development program. This initiative aims to secure state grants to enhance broadband access in the area, which is increasingly vital for residents and businesses alike.
